The Blind Spot: Why We Miss the Whole Picture

SECTION

Nova: It absolutely is. Let's dive into this "blind spot" first. Imagine a city grappling with a severe traffic problem. The immediate, intuitive solution? Build more roads, widen the existing ones. Seems logical, right? More capacity, less congestion.

Atlas: Right, that's the classic knee-jerk reaction. More space equals faster flow. Or so we think.

Nova: But what often happens? For a brief period, traffic might improve. But then, something fascinating, and frustrating, occurs: induced demand. More roads encourage more people to drive, or people who used to avoid peak hours now join in. Businesses sprawl further out, increasing commute distances. Suddenly, those new lanes are just as clogged as the old ones, sometimes even worse, and the city has spent billions.

Atlas: Wow. So, the "solution" actually became part of the problem, or at least failed to solve the underlying issue. That's a perfect example of focusing on a symptom—the congestion—without understanding the system—how urban planning, public transport, human behavior, and infrastructure all interact.

Nova: Precisely. We saw the traffic, a symptom, and not the system of urban mobility. This fragmented view leads us down rabbit holes, chasing symptoms without ever addressing the root causes. It’s like trying to cure a fever by simply turning down the thermostat, while ignoring the infection raging inside.

Atlas: That’s a powerful analogy. But why are we so prone to this? Is it just easier to see the immediate, tangible problem? For someone trying to innovate, it feels counterintuitive to slow down and zoom out when there's pressure to deliver quick fixes.

Nova: It is easier, and there are deep evolutionary reasons. Our brains are incredible pattern-matching machines, optimized for immediate threats and simple cause-and-effect in our direct environment. But complex systems, especially social or ecological ones, operate on time delays, feedback loops, and non-linear relationships. Our instinct is to simplify, to compartmentalize, and that's where the blind spot forms. We often reward quick, visible solutions, even if they're ultimately superficial.

Atlas: So, for leaders and strategists, this means they could be pushing for solutions that look good on paper, get immediate applause, but are actually setting them up for bigger problems down the line? That sounds like a recipe for burnout and frustration, for themselves and their teams.

Nova: Absolutely. It’s a common trap in business, in policy, even in personal development. You might work harder, but if you're not addressing the underlying system that's creating the inefficiency or stress, you're just running faster on a treadmill. It's about recognizing that almost everything is part of a larger system, and those systems have their own behaviors and rules.

The Shift: Embracing Systems Thinking for Lasting Change

SECTION

Nova: So, if the blind spot is seeing parts, the shift is about consciously training ourselves to see the whole. This is where Donella Meadows' work, "Thinking in Systems," becomes an absolute cornerstone. She teaches us that the world isn't just a collection of separate events; it's a tapestry of interconnected systems. Every action creates a reaction, often in unexpected places, and often with a delay.

Atlas: Okay, so it’s about understanding the ripple effect, but more profoundly. What does "seeing interconnected systems" actually look like in practice? Can you give an example where this shift in perspective truly made a difference, something that wasn't immediately obvious?

Nova: Let's consider a public health crisis, like childhood obesity. A fragmented approach might focus on individual responsibility: "Eat less, exercise more." While true, it misses the system. A systems thinker would zoom out. They'd look at food deserts in low-income neighborhoods, lack of safe places for kids to play, aggressive marketing of unhealthy foods, school lunch programs, parental stress, economic inequality. They'd see that obesity isn't just a personal choice issue; it's a symptom of a complex socio-economic-environmental system.

Atlas: And what would a solution from that systems perspective look like? Because "eat less, exercise more" clearly isn't enough.

Nova: Exactly. A systems approach might lead to initiatives like: incentivizing grocery stores to open in food deserts, funding community centers with safe play areas, regulating food marketing to children, or even addressing minimum wage to alleviate parental stress, which impacts food choices. The "leverage points" – those small changes that yield large results – aren't always where you'd expect. Meadows would say they're often in the mindsets or the goals of the system, not just the physical flows.

Atlas: That's fascinating. So, instead of just telling people to fix themselves, you're looking at the environment and structures that shape their choices. It’s about creating a system where healthy choices are the easier, more natural choices. That feels much more impactful for long-term change, especially for a nurturer who cares about broader growth.

Nova: It is. And Peter Senge, in "The Fifth Discipline," builds on this by introducing the "learning organization." He argues that for organizations to truly adapt and thrive, they need to cultivate systems thinking collectively. It’s not just about one brilliant individual seeing the whole; it’s about an entire group learning to perceive and respond to these interconnected dynamics together. This fosters collective intelligence and allows for continuous adaptation, which is vital for any innovator.

Atlas: I’m curious, then. How does one even start to cultivate this "zoomed-out" lens? It sounds like a complete rewiring of how you approach every problem. Is it something that can be learned, or does it take a certain kind of genius? For someone leading teams or building new ventures, the stakes are high.

Nova: It absolutely can be learned, Atlas. It's not about being a genius; it's about developing new habits of mind. Meadows herself emphasized that systems thinking is a skill, a way of seeing. It starts with asking different questions: "What are the boundaries of this system?" "What are the feedback loops here?" "Who benefits, and who pays the cost?" "What are the unintended consequences of this action?" It's a continuous practice of stepping back and observing the patterns, not just the events.

Atlas: So, it's about cultivating a kind of meta-awareness, a constant questioning of your own assumptions about how things work. That's a huge shift from just reacting to problems as they arise.

Nova: Exactly. Let's take that team dynamic example. If you're constantly dealing with low morale or missed deadlines, the symptom-focused approach might be to implement stricter rules, or demand more hours. But zooming out, a systems thinker might ask: "What are the incentives driving this behavior? Is there a lack of clarity in roles? Is the communication structure inhibiting collaboration? Are individuals feeling unsupported or unheard?" The underlying system could be anything from a poorly designed workflow to an unaddressed power imbalance.

Atlas: So, the immediate fix might be a band-aid, but the systems approach actually redesigns the body that’s getting cut. That’s a powerful distinction. For someone who values integrated application and seamlessness, this is about getting to the true leverage points. What's a simple first step someone can take to start applying this today?

Nova: A great first step is to simply map out your problem. Grab a pen and paper, or a whiteboard. Instead of just listing the problem, start drawing arrows. "If A happens, then B happens. But B also impacts C, and C feeds back into A." Look for circles, for delays, for places where a small change might create a surprisingly large effect. Don't try to solve it yet; just try to understand the connections. It's like building a mental model of your challenge.

Atlas: That’s a practical exercise. It forces you to externalize your thinking and see the relationships. It's about moving from a linear 'if-then' mindset to a more circular, interconnected view. That's a great way to start practicing cognitive optimization.
